Options price a ±15.6% move into FCEL's Sep 2 earnings

FCEL reports on Wednesday, September 2 after the close. The at-the-money straddle covering that report prices a ±15.6% move — roughly $14.99 to $20.53 from $17.76. FCEL has averaged ±13.5% on its last 7 earnings reactions (biggest: 24%), so this print is priced at 1.2× its own history.
